So over the past year, liberals have called Donald Trump every single solitary name in the book for wanting to build a wall and secure the border. Now, Breitbart, they were reporting that there were 7,712 terrorist encounters that occurred within the United States in one year, and many of those encounters occurred near the US-Mexico border.

0:18.6

The incidents are characterized as, quote, known or suspected terrorist encounters. Some of those encounters occurred near the US-Mexico border at ports of entry, and some occurred in between indicating that persons known or reasonably suspected of being terrorists, while they attempted to sneak into the US across the border.

0:35.5

In all, the encounters occurred in higher numbers in border states. So is it really that deplorable to want to build a wall and reform our immigration system to keep Americans safe?
